Producer's Notes

Founded in the 1540’s, the Tomita Brewery is one of the oldest breweries in Japan and is now managed by the 15th generation of the family, Yasunobu Tomita, who is also the brewmaster. The Tomita’s named their sake Shichi Hon Yari, or 'Seven Spearsmen,' after the leaders of the historic Battle of Shizugatake which was fought just outside their town of Kinomoto. Shichi Hon Yari Junmai is the classic representation of the brewery’s style with its traditional and modern dimensions. Earthy and rich aromatics and flavors meet elegance and softness in the finish. The bright acidity makes this a fun sake to pair with dishes outside of traditional Japanese cuisine, including Duck a l’orange and Yukhoe, Korean Steak Tartare. This is a perfect Sake to enjoy with Thanksgiving dinner. It is rich and earthy with notes of dried mushrooms with a crisp finish. This is one of the more versatile Sakes, as it will pair well with Roast Turkey, Charcuterie, Rich Risotto, or a hearty Stew. This can also be served at various temperatures; cold is good, room temperature is better, and hot is exceptional. This is a fuller body sake from the Shiga Region made with Tamazakae Rice. - JD Arredondo DRY & EARTHY The Tomita Brewery in the Tiga prefecture is the 3rd oldest Sake brewery in Japan and produces this crisp sake with great umami flavors of dried mushroom and roasted cashew. Shichi Hon Yari Junmai is made with Tamasakae Rice and is named for the Seven Spearsmen that fought in the battle of Shizugatake outside the town of Kinomoto, home of the Tomita brewery. Pair with Jamon Iberico, Olives, and Marcona Almonds. Recommended Serving Temperature: 40°-50°F, 65°-75°F, 95°-105°F, or 120°-130°F
